WebThe ANSI/ASHRAE 55 (2010) standard proposes a graphic comfort zone method, shown in figure 2 (on the left), to assess thermal comfort which considers operative temperature and humidity, applicable to environments with an air speed below 0.2 m/s, in which users' activities are mainly sedentary (1.0 to 1.3 met) and their clothing has a thermal ...
